CONSUMER PROTECTION ASSOCIATION OF AMERICA

CPA is a member organization that invites businesses and their customers to join together to change how business will be done into the 21st century. CPA gives members and others effective tools for communication and complaint resolution no matter where or when the transaction takes place. Whether you're a business or a consumer, when someone promises to provide you with a product or service, you deserve to get what you expect!

When you receive more than you expect...let the business know with CPA's Thank You! card. And, when you don't, use CPA's You Blew It! card. As a member, you receive copies of both to hand out in person...or, send them via e-mail using the links provided.

If you need to, file a complaint following CPA's guidelines and sample complaint letter. And, if the business still doesn't do the "right thing", you can file a formal complaint with CPA. We can even provide formal arbitration services if needed.
